Transaction 57997cac29b1761418da8451eeea591bb49c7194bca08fec11fa0b880e64c8f0
1 Input
2 Outputs
- 57997cac29b1761418da8451eeea591bb49c7194bca08fec11fa0b880e64c8f0:0
- 57997cac29b1761418da8451eeea591bb49c7194bca08fec11fa0b880e64c8f0:1
value 48910
address 1M5A7G2sxpQx2w3KpC8U8zjSR8MFiSiNLw
value 139125
address 13EejaoQXVjBZ9mPGRKEQ6a7RybY8x2jSd